As a project of which there are rare examples all over the world, the Marmaray tunnel that is planned to be installed at Istanbul Bosphorus had become an important source of the government for advertising. The workers employed at Marmaray building site have led a resistance which has become one of the most important ones in the last months. The workers that receive a very low salary and haven't had a pay rise for years aren't paid their insurance and must work in very unhealthy conditions. Before, they had made many times actions and stopped work.
The Marmaray workers employed at the Polat Deniz Insaat subcontracting firm have lead a resistance since January 16, 2010 to improve the working conditions and to receive a salary appropriate to a human life. The workers occupied the construction area at Yenikapi, Istanbul on March 4. The occupation was realised by 40 workers when Kadir Topbas, mayor of Istanbul, visited the construction area for control. The workers shouted the slogans "The workers aren't alone" and "The day will come where everything will change and the bosses will render account to the workers". Due to the occupation, the boss had to accept to meet up with the workers and also accept different demands including to re-employ 60 workers who had been dismissed by him before. However, when the boss didn't sign the protocol on March 12 demanded by the workers, the workers again occupied their work place on March 17. More than 30 workers occupied the work place for a second time and carried the banner read "We are resisting for our work and rights". The boss promised again to have a meeting with the workers.
The trial of the workers to become re-employed started at the Labour Court at Sirkeci courthouse on March 24. The workers made an action in front of the court. The trial was postponed to May 28.
The Marmaray workers are following the way paved by the TEKEL workers. The solidarity between the workers and the common resistance strengthened the Marmaray resistance. The TEKEL resistance that started in mid December has become a very important struggle from which the working class movement won lots of important experience. This struggle became a topic on the political agenda of the class movement in the country, put pressure on the traditional yellow unions and drew the attention on itself of a broad social group. The TEKEL resistance gave power to other workers' resistances, too. The Marmaray resistance has become quite important in terms of being a resistance developing under the great influence of the TEKEL resistance. The Marmaray workers also attracted attention with their solidarity taken over from the TEKEL workers. The workers visited the workers of ATV-Sabah who have been leading a resistance for more than 1 year and showed solidarity with them. The Marmaray workers supported actions on different social questions and participated in marches.
The Marmaray workers's visit of the TEKEL workers has been symbolising the peak of he continuance that couldn't be achieved in terms of the class movement The TEKEL workers shared the money they received for solidarity with the Marmaray workers and by that, they once more displayed another true example of solidarity.
The working class movement that understood the importance of mutual solidarity has also been aware of the bosses that try to separate them from the unions such as Textil-Sen which are following the line of the class and show the workers the real way leading to their liberation. The Marmaray workers said "Textil-Sen is representing our will" and declared that they won't accept to meet up with the bosses without the union.
The way from TEKEL to the Marmaray resistance is giving hope in terms of the course of development of the class movement under the destructing results of the world economic crisis.
